Analyst - Reconciliation & Compliance Reporting (RCA)
Analyst - Reconciliation & Compliance Reporting, (RCA) has a keen eye for detail and a passion for process and numbers. They review every detail of our client invoicing, including management fees, vendor costs, and all supporting backups. They make sure the M&IW program leads have all necessary signed agreements, approvals, cost savings worksheets, final documents/invoices, etc. in place. The RCA is responsible for assembling the M&IW Final Invoice and/or the Compliance Reports required by the M&IW healthcare/medical device clients.
